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
52671351 2956 65199502 35838751373
56 038591933
56 038591933
06 7988260 0743 2970
All about undefined
Interested in learning more?
56 038591933
06 7988260 0743 2970
See more
3972904 61
11293406 59570 22339713
See more
946433490 54216895068 95390
248399 29880 6320 951 662
See more